Camelot 30K

Hard SF novel about alien life at 30 Kelvin.

Camelot 30K is a hard science fiction novel by American physicist Robert L. Forward, released in 1993 by Tor Books. The story centers on humanity's first contact with intelligent aliens inhabiting a frozen world with an average temperature of 30 K (−240 °C). Forward employs exotic low-temperature chemistry to account for the aliens' biology and anatomy.

In 2009, humans detect a signal from beyond Neptune and Pluto, originating from 1999 ZX, a Kuiper belt object 35 AU from the Sun. Twenty years later, a scientific team is sent to this small, ice-bound planetoid in the Oort cloud. The world has a thin hydrogen atmosphere near vacuum, with an average temperature of 30 K, where only hydrogen, helium, and neon remain gaseous; nearly everything else is solid. Despite these conditions, life thrives: the keracks, a few centimeters long, resemble "large one-eyed prawns dressed in elaborate clothing." They have built small cities on their planetoid, which they call "Ice," and developed a collectivistic, hive-like society with a culture reminiscent of King Arthur's England.

First contact occurs with Merlene, a female kerack wizard from the city of Camalor. Humans, too large and hot for direct interaction, use telebots to communicate with Merlene and other keracks. Merlene grows fond of conversing with the humans, and both sides learn about each other's worlds. Humans teach Merlene science and technology to advance her race. The scientists also discover the keracks' energy source: each kerack secretes an internal uranium pellet, moderated by a boron-rich carapace to provide warmth. When a kerack dies, its pellet is stockpiled by the colony's queen. The humans uncover a tragic cycle: when enough pellets accumulate, the queen instinctively arranges them to trigger a nuclear explosion, blasting kerack spores off the object to colonize others. Since the colony is destroyed, no living kerack knows this fate. The book ends with Merlene traveling to warn other colonies about the dangers of their growing stockpiles.

The name "1999 ZX" is impossible under minor planet naming conventions, as such a designation does not exist.
